Trial Court Properly Found For Homeowners Insurer In Water, Mold Damage Suit

(June 3, 2020, 12:01 PM EDT) -- PHOENIX — The Division 1 Arizona Court of Appeals on June 2 determined that a trial court properly found that a homeowners insurer did not breach its contract or act in bad faith in handling a claim for water and mold damages because there is no evidence that the insurer breached any portion of the insurance contract or acted unreasonably in handling the claim (Athena Finney Lane Jacobson v. Mercury Casualty Co., No. 1 CA-CV 19-0246, Ariz. App., Div. 1, 2020 Ariz. App. Unpub. LEXIS 593). ...
